VC 220 Dome WDR Day/Night PoE Network Camera Administration Guide
Q.
How can I find out my camera's IP address?
By default, the camera automatically receives a DHCP IP address. To
identify the IP address, you can do the following procedure:
On a computer connected to your router go to Start > Run.
Type cmd window.
At command line, type ipconfig.
Look for Default Gateway. This is your LAN router's ip address
In a web browser, login to your router by typing the router's IP address.
Each router shows the IP address differently.
Look for a DHCP client table that lists DHCP IP addresses. It can be found on
the Summary, Status > LAN, or DHCP page.
Look for your camera's MAC address. The camera's IP address should be
next to your MAC address.
